Description

This handloom Kanchipuram silk saree, meticulously crafted on traditional fly-shuttle pit looms by artisans, embodies the earthy vibrancy of terracotta-orange resham body interwoven with a subtle check pattern—a hue evoking sun-baked temple bricks and harvest abundance in ancient Tamil rituals. Gracefully framing the pure silk are the striking red korvai borders—hand-interlocked for seamless elegance—adorned with gold zari geometric motifs, traditional checks, and serrated edges reminiscent of Chola-era temple friezes symbolizing stability and prosperity.

Handloom :
Authentic handloom sarees are crafted by skilled artisans using traditional techniques, resulting in unique characteristics such as extra loose threads, slight weave irregularities, or minor color variations. These features are not defects or damage but hallmarks of genuine handloom quality, ensuring each piece is one-of-a-kind. Gentle care, like dry cleaning only, preserves their heritage beauty for generations.
